2026 OpenClaw 첫 완주:
원격 Mac M4 Pro에서의 install.sh, npm, doctor, Gateway 18789

싱가포르, 일본, 한국, 홍콩, 미국 동부, 미국 서부 중 한 곳의 베어 메탈 Mac mini M4 ProOpenClaw를 올려 첫 업무 메시지가 안정적으로 왕복하게 만들 때 시간을 잡아먹는 것은 명령 개수가 아닙니다. 설치 경로가 감사 가능한지, Node 메이저가 공식 문서의 동결 시점과 맞는지, openclaw doctor 출력을 구조화된 텔레메트리로 다루는지, 그리고 Gateway 기본 포트 18789장시간 SSH, launchd 콜드 스타트, 필요 시 리버스 프록시 사이에서 일관되는지가 핵심입니다. 본문은 첫 완주 패턴을 제시합니다. 가격은 요금 페이지, 주문은 주문 페이지, 접속 정책은 고객 센터입니다. 디스크 상시 구동과 업그레이드는 install 및 디스크 글, 업그레이드 글, 채널 및 프록시 글과 함께 읽습니다.

읽은 뒤 다음 세 가지를 근거로 답할 수 있어야 합니다. 첫째, 첫 이주일을 표준화할 단일 설치 경로입니다. 둘째, doctor 출력을 변경 티켓에 첨부해 차분 가능하게 만드는 운용입니다. 셋째, 로컬 도달성과 네트워크 도달성을 분리해 관측하는 절차입니다. 명령과 버전 문자열은 병합 당일 공식 저장소와 설치 문서로 다시 확인합니다.

  • CLI가 버전만 출력하면 Gateway 완료로 오인: 첫 완주의 정의는 대화형 셸에서 한 번 돌아간 것이 아니라 제어 평면 포트 동작과 데몬 맥락이 운영 가정과 일치하는 것입니다.
  • 이중 경로 혼선: 스크립트로 깐 런타임에 같은 접두사로 npm 전역을 겹치면 이중 openclaw와 PATH 순서 유령 장애가 재부팅 뒤에 드러납니다.
  • Node 설명의 노후화: 이차 자료는 Node 22 어휘에 머무르기 쉬우나 공식 측은 Node 24 권장 등으로 이동합니다. 변경 티켓에 문서 날짜를 쓰지 않으면 리뷰가 공회전합니다.
  • 디스크 기울기 과소평가: 첫 주는 작아 보여도 둘째 주부터 재시도와 왕복이 기울기를 바꿉니다. 디렉터리 기준과 여유 공간 임계가 없으면 재시작 의존으로 퇴행합니다.
  • 세션과 상시 혼용: 불안정한 핫스팟으로 설치하고 launchd 콜드 검증을 주말로 미루면 무관한 두 실패 유형이 겹칩니다.
  • 좁은 메모리에서 병렬: IDE와 시뮬레이터와 Gateway를 동시에 돌리면 지연을 모델 품질 문제로 오인하기 쉽습니다.

표는 첫 완주에 초점을 맞춘 비교입니다. 조직에 패키지 정책이 있으면 그쪽을 우선합니다.

OpenClaw 첫 설치 경로 비교
경로 첫 실행 이점 첫 실행 리스크와 완화
공식 install.sh 클린 머신에서 공유 어휘를 빠르게 맞출 수 있습니다 스크립트 판본과 전체 콘솔 로그를 매번 보관합니다
npm 전역 변경 감사에 가까운 버전 어휘를 제공합니다 Node 메이저와 전역 접두사를 고정하고 데몬 맥락을 별도 검증합니다
병렬 랩 다른 사용자나 다른 접두사로 A와 B를 분리합니다 창 종료 시 시험 접두사를 물리 삭제해 PATH 오스위치를 막습니다

실무적으로는 첫 안정 메시지까지 단일 주 경로로 모으고 보조 경로는 라벨 붙은 실험으로만 둡니다.

공식 입구는 릴리스마다 움직입니다. 아래 URL은 검증 앵커입니다.

https://docs.openclaw.ai/install/

https://www.npmjs.com/package/openclaw

https://github.com/openclaw/openclaw

변경 티켓에 다음 세 가지 절대 경로를 고정합니다. node 실행 파일, openclaw 실행 파일, gateway 리슨 튜플입니다. 대화형 SSH와 콜드 서비스 시작 모두에서 같은 출력을 반복합니다. doctor가 Node를 거부하면 첫 마일스톤 위반으로 취급하고 장식적 경고로 두지 않습니다.

첫 실행용 간단 신호 대응표
신호 1차 의심 권장 조치
Node 거부 nvm 기본값, 다중 메이저, launchd가 셸 초기화를 상속하지 않음 데몬과 동일 사용자 맥락에서 node -vwhich node를 다시 출력합니다
바인드나 포트 오래된 gateway, 과밀한 헬스 체크, 18789 공유 충돌 리스너 목록 뒤 변경 창에서 순서 정지와 재시작을 합니다
자격 증명이나 경로 작업 공간 이동, HOME 불일치, 임시 export만 있는 키 디렉터리 경계를 런북에 쓰고 키 로테이션 뒤 doctor를 재실행합니다

리전 간 RTT는 체감 지연을 바꾸지만 준비 완료의 정의는 바꾸지 않습니다. 준비 완료는 포트 동작과 안정 프로세스와 설명 가능한 로그 기울기입니다.

검증을 두 단계로 나눕니다. 첫 단계는 머신 위 설정과 도달성입니다. 둘째 단계는 운영자나 자동화가 넘는 네트워크 경로입니다. 공인 노출이 필요하면 공식 보안 지침과 사내 제로 트러스트 정책을 따릅니다.

first-run-probe.sh
node -v
which openclaw
openclaw --version
openclaw doctor
openclaw gateway status
curl -fsS http://127.0.0.1:18789/ || true

로컬 CLI가 다른 포트를 보이면 프로브를 그 출력에 맞게 바꾸고 같은 티켓에 첨부합니다.

  1. 동결 기록: OS 판, 패치, Node 메이저, openclaw 읽기 방식을 적습니다.
  2. 단일 주 경로: install.sh 또는 npm 전역 중 하나를 고르고 같은 날 같은 접두사 혼선을 금지합니다.
  3. 설치 실행: 공식 절차를 따르고 콘솔 전문을 보관합니다.
  4. doctor: 원시 출력을 티켓에 붙이고 표와 대조해 빨간 항목을 없앱니다.
  5. 데몬: onboard --install-daemon 또는 현행 동등 절차를 넣고 사용자 로그아웃 뒤에도 검증합니다.
  6. 18789 로컬 검증: curl 등으로 로컬 도달을 먼저 통과합니다.
  7. 디스크 기준: 작업 공간과 로그와 캐시를 분리하고 여유 공간 임계를 정합니다.
  8. 상업 자원 정렬: 세션과 단계를 확인한 뒤 주문 페이지에 반영하고 약관은 요금 페이지, 제한은 고객 센터에서 확인합니다.

  • 제어 평면 포트: 커뮤니티 자료는 18789를 로컬 제어 면으로 자주 설명합니다. 실제 리슨은 status 출력으로 확인합니다.
  • Node 서술: npm 페이지와 설치 문서에 Node 22.16 이상Node 24 권장 같은 범위가 있습니다. 병합일에 다시 읽습니다.
  • 설치 입구: install.sh와 패키지 관리자 절차는 공식에 있습니다. 동작 세부는 그쪽을 따릅니다.
  • NOVAKVM: 위 육 지역에서 베어 메탈 Mac mini를 제공하고 M4 Pro와 고메모리 디스크 단계를 제공해 상시 Gateway와 도구 체인에 맞춥니다.

모호한 공유 클라우드 데스크톱이나 소비자급 공유 호스팅은 이웃 노이즈와 수면 정책과 라이선스 회색지대로 숨은 비용을 키우기 쉽습니다. 개인 핫스팟에 첫 실행을 묶으면 세션 끊김이 앱 결함처럼 보입니다. 감사 가능한 업그레이드 경로와 노트북과 운영형 데몬의 분리가 필요하면 전용 Apple Silicon 베어 메탈로 옮기는 편이 현실적입니다.

소형 자작 호스트와 지역 분산 고메모리 Mac mini를 비교한다면 먼저 NOVAKVM 요금 페이지에서 디스크와 메모리와 임대 기간을 맞추고 주문 페이지에서 이 주일 로그 기울기 실험을 돌립니다. 육 지역 저지연 입구와 M4 Pro 여유를 OpenClaw 첫 실행과 상시에 동시에 얹으려면 NOVAKVM 클라우드 베어 메탈 임대가 운영 경계와 업그레이드 설명 모두에서 유리해지기 쉽습니다. 색인은 엔지니어링 블로그입니다.